Marsha Ross presents the many layers of concern in the business of beekeeping through her plexiglass sculpture. Her illuminated panels show bees goiong about their business -  the industrious work of pollinating crops, and also the agri-business practices that put bees in danger. Her full-scale plexiglass hive symbolically shows a multi-layered view of bees and the threats to their future looming behind them.
